問題タブ [apache2]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
1291 参照

php - ホスティングに関する別の質問: Linux、Apache2、PHP5、PostGreSQL 8.3

以下の環境を提供しているホスティング会社をどなたかお勧めいただければ幸いです。グーグルで検索できることはわかっていますが、そのような会社で働いた経験のある人を探しているので、最初にここで質問しています.

  1. Linux ボックス。
  2. アパッチ 2.0。
  3. PHP5 (正確には 5.2.6)。
  4. PostGreSQL (8.3.1)。
  5. 彼らが何をしているかを知っている素晴らしい技術サポート。

なぜ私が新しいホストを探しているのかについての背景情報を少し。私は、現在彼のサイトをホストしているクライアントのためにフリーランスの PHP 作業を行っています。名前は H で始まり、姓は V (匿名性のため) で始まります。彼らは素晴らしい会社だと確信していますが、昨夜、私は彼らの Web ポータルを初めて目にすることができました。

私は最新のホスティング会社を探しています (私の個人サイトは godaddy によってホストされており、彼らが得るかもしれないすべての否定的な点は、彼らのホスティング コントロール センターは素晴らしい IMO です)。

私はすでにクライアントと話しましたが、彼らはホスティング会社を切り替えることにオープンであるため、問題はありません. セットアップしたローカル マシンですべての作業を行っているため、テクニカル サポートと協力して、同一のサーバー セットアップを取得できるようにしたいと考えています。正しいphp拡張機能を有効にしたり、iniファイルを変更したりするなどの簡単なこと。http認証によってアクセスが制御されているサイトの一部もあるため、技術者と協力して正しく設定する必要があります. Webルート外のフォルダへのアクセスも間違いなくプラスです(たとえば、私の知る限り、godaddyはftp経由でこれを許可していません)。

以前このサイトで働いていたプログラマーは、現在のホスティング会社の技術者と少し話し、pg_hba.conf ファイルを正しくセットアップすることさえできないという印象を受けました。

また、既に pgPhpAdmin をインストールして提供しているか、自分でインストールできるように pg_hba.conf ファイルを適切に編集できる会社を探しています。古いサイトのデータベースと完成する新しいサイトのデータベースの違いはかなり大きいので、このようなツールがあると、サイトをオンラインにしてデータベースが正しくセットアップされていることを確認する際に非常に役立ちます。 .

とにかく、長々とした投稿で申し訳ありません。返信ありがとうございます。

0 投票する
2 に答える
1478 参照

apache2 - Windows/Apache2.2 環境での Windows loginID ヘルプ

些細な問題のように見える問題を解決するために、私は本当に助けを借りることができました. 要約すると、Windows 環境の Apache で実行されている Perl .cgi にアクセスするユーザーの Window の loginID を知りたいです。

これが私の基本的なApache2 confの追加です:

---- httpd.conf の開始 -----

---- httpd.conf の終了 ------

さらに、http: //tortoisesvn.net/docs/release/TortoiseSVN_en/tsvn-serversetup.html#tsvn-serversetup-apache-7の優れた手順を使用して、自分のマシンで SSL を有効にしました。

上記のサイトは Apache モジュール mod_auth.so をロードするように要求していますが、デフォルトの Apache2 インストールでは見つかりません。また、ご覧のとおり、mod_auth_sspi-1.0.4-2.2.2 モジュールを手動で Apache2 環境に追加しました。

ここで、 http://localhost/cgi-bin/test.cgihttps: //localhost/cgi-bin/test.cgi の両方を試してみると、 http/ の REMOTE_USER の方法で何も表示されません環境変数。https 呼び出しで大量の SSL 変数が表示されるため、SSL が機能していることはわかっています。また、SSL の要件はありませんが、上記のリンクに Windows ログイン情報を取得するために必要であると記載されているため、SSL のみを使用しています。

洞察力をいただければ幸いです。参考になれば、httpd.conf ファイル全体を喜んで共有します。基本的に、繰り返しますが、私が探しているのは、Windows/Apache2.2 ホスティング環境の Perl .cgi で Windows loginID を取得する方法だけです。

皆様のご協力に感謝いたします。

サケル・ガニ

0 投票する
2 に答える
1816 参照

apache2 - Apache: SSI 内部の SSI

インクルード ファイル内にインクルード ファイルを含める方法はありますか? (それを5倍速く言ってください!)

例えば:

index.htmlの内部:

include1.shtmlの内部:

したがって、ツリーは次のようになります。index.html <-- include_1.shtml <-- include_2.shtml

現状では、これは私の Apache では機能しません。最初のインクルードは正常に機能しますが、ネストされたインクルードのコンテンツは表示されません。

関連するので、私は Apache 2 で XBitHack を使用しており、両方のファイルが Web ユーザーによって実行可能であることを再確認しました。

ヘルプ?

0 投票する
4 に答える
1855 参照

apache - LocationMatchおよびDAVsvn

複数のURLを介してSubversionリポジトリにアクセスできるようにしようとしています。そのために、LocationMatchディレクティブを使用することを考えていました。私の構成は次のとおりです。

上記の構成は機能しません。奇妙なことに、たとえばこの構成を使用すると、両方のURLでうまく機能します。

私にとって、DAV svnとLocationMatchの組み合わせは実際には機能していないように見えますか、それともここで何か間違ったことをしていますか?

0 投票する
3 に答える
9327 参照

php - Windowsサーバー上のApacheはファイルに書き込めません

Windows Server 2003 に Apache 2.2 をインストールしました。

Apache がディスク上のファイルに書き込めるようにしたいのですが、Apache がどのユーザーとして動作するのかわかりません。

Apache が Windows サーバー 2003 上のファイルに書き込めるようにするにはどうすればよいですか?

更新: ユーザーは「SYSTEM」として実行されており、そのユーザーにすべてのフォルダーとファイルへの完全なアクセス許可を付与しようとしました。また、すべてのフォルダとファイルに対する「Everyone」の完全なアクセス許可を与えています。Apache を再起動し、すべての Cookie を消去し、IE を再起動しましたが、phpMyAdmin から書き込み権限がないというメッセージが表示されます。

0 投票する
2 に答える
63071 参照

apache - 要求された URL / はこのサーバーで見つかりませんでした

同じサーバーに 2 つの Apache インスタンスがあり、1 つはポート 80 に、もう 1 つは別のポートにあります。最初のものは正常に動作します。mydomain.com:otherport にアクセスすると、タイトルにあるエラー メッセージが表示されます。ディレクトリは存在し、Web サーバーが実行されているのと同じユーザーとグループを持っています。

0 投票する
3 に答える
5216 参照

apache2 - mod_python with apache2、モジュールの(再)インポートエラー

mod-python を apache2 で動作させようとしていますが、成功していません。mod-python を動作させるためのいくつかのチュートリアルに従いましたが、何が間違っているのかわかりません。

http://site.example.com/cgi-bin/test.pyにアクセスすると、実際に 404 ページが表示されます! (一方、ファイルが実際に存在しない場合は 403 禁止されます)

これが私のセットアップです:

/etc/apache2/sites-enabled/ には、各ドメインにちなんで名付けられた構成ファイルがあります。site.example.com ファイルで、これをユーザー ディレクティブ セクションに追加しました。

次の行を含む完全なファイルはこちらです。

test.pyの内容を追加するための編集:

上記のように、404 /python/test.py was not found on this server.

しかし、最後の行のコメントを外すと、次のようになります。

このトレースバックは正しく見えますか? ちなみに、cgitb を有効にしても効果はありません。

これを診断するために追加できる他の情報はありますか?

0 投票する
2 に答える
25028 参照

apache2 - apache 000-デフォルトの仮想ホスト

000-default の仮想ホストがあることがわかりましたが、そのままにしておきました。mysite.com の新しいファイルとリンクを作成しましたが、動作しますが、希望どおりに動作しません。000-default vh を削除する必要があるかどうか、または削除してはならないかどうか、誰かが知っていますか?

何らかの理由で、http://mysite.comにアクセスすると 000-default サイトに移動しますが、http://www.mysite.comに移動すると正しい場所に移動します。なぜ違いがあるのですか?

これは mysite.com の vh ファイルです。

0 投票する
3 に答える
14798 参照

apache2 - Apache はどのように FQDN を決定しますか?

私はApache2を使用していますが、サーバーをリロード/再起動すると、次の警告が表示されます:

apache2: Could not reliably determine the server's fully qualified domain name, using (my FQDN) for ServerName

すべて正常に動作しますが、エラーの原因を突き止めようとしています。私はそれを見つけることができるかどうかを確認するためにソースをつかんでいますが、私のCはあまり良くないので....

いくつかのメモ:

  • システムのホスト名を変更すると、Apache は新しいホスト名を使用します
  • 私はServerNameセットを持っています。ホスト名と同じです
  • 私は静的で一意の IP を持っています -dig (hostname)リターン (私の ip)、dig -x (my ip)リターン (ホスト名)
  • 私のホストファイルは正しいです

バージョン:

何か案は?

0 投票する
4 に答える
4451 参照

php - open_basedir not having any effect

For my web hosting panel, users need to be blocked from accessing files outside their own directory (/var/www/u/s/username). I tried to use this line in httpd.conf to prevent people from going up a directory.

But in php.ini, it seems to have no effect. What am I doing wrong?